It's become expected in society for women to shave off most of their body hair, but whether you choose to do so or not is up to you - and there's nothing wrong with deciding to embrace your natural look.
For one woman on TikTok, opting not to shave her legs for a month has led to an argument with her boyfriend, who ultimately decided to break up with her because he thought the sight of her hairy legs was "gross".
Posting a video on her account, @bonedrymilkers, the woman - who does not share her name online - showed screenshots of a text message conversation she'd had with her boyfriend after she sent him a picture of her legs and joked that she "hadn't shaved since Christmas".

But her lighthearted message backfired when her partner replied: "Yeah, I've noticed. You should really get on that. It's kind of gross, to be honest."
The woman told her boyfriend it's "not that serious" and said she was planning on shaving soon but had been "embracing the winter coat" in the cold weather.
Her boyfriend then doubled down on his comments, stating: "No, you should be embarrassed. It's really just unhygienic for a female. Plus it's a total turn off."
After asking if he was "serious", the man then responded: "Yeah, talk to me when you shave your legs."

The woman's video went viral and currently has over 18 million views, which has prompted her to share an updated video with more text messages between the pair.
Defending herself in one message, the woman told her partner: "What you said earlier was just stupid, and I know you're not going to like hearing this, but I posted what you said on TikTok and people are agreeing with me. It's normal for women to have body hair, and it's not like I said I never shave. I just haven't in a while. That's why I sent you a picture - because I thought it was funny. Your reaction was childish."
But the boyfriend still wasn't impressed, as he told her he "prefers our legs not to have the same feel" and claimed he couldn't believe people online were siding with her.
The woman said at the end of her video: "Update - we did in fact break up."
Comments on the videos were divided, with many people defending the woman's choice to not shave her legs - but others agreeing with the boyfriend's opinion.
One person said: "The misogyny and double standards flow so freely out this man."
While another added: "The way I'd never speak to him again after this."
But someone else disagreed, stating: "He's kind of right though."
